Target Information

The Folate receptor gamma, encoded by the FOLR3 gene in cattle, plays a crucial role in folate uptake. It is primarily localized in haematopoietic tissues, such as the spleen and bone marrow, where it functions as a secretory protein. Interestingly, an increase in FOLR3 levels can effectively mitigate homocysteine (Hcy) in the blood, thereby reducing Hcy-induced toxicity-even in tissues with low expression levels of FOLR1 and FOLR2.
